What Makes a Water-Resistant Camera Bag?
Before we dive into the specifics of what to look for, it’s essential to understand that no camera bag can make your gear completely waterproof. However, a high-quality water-resistant camera bag can significantly reduce the risk of damage from exposure to moisture.
There are several key factors to consider when evaluating a water-resistant camera bag:
Material and Construction
The material used in the construction of the bag plays a significant role in determining its water-resistance. Look for bags made from durable, waterproof materials such as nylon, polyester, or PVC-coated fabrics. Avoid bags with cheap or flimsy materials that may not withstand exposure to moisture.
Another critical aspect is the design and architecture of the bag. A well-designed bag should have a sealed zipper, reinforced stress points, and a water-resistant coating on the exterior.
Water-Resistant Coatings
Many camera bags come with a water-resistant coating, which can provide an additional layer of protection against moisture. However, these coatings may not be suitable for all types of materials or applications.
When evaluating a water-resistant coating, consider the following:
- Type of coating: Look for bags with a hydrophobic (water-repelling) coating, as these are more effective at preventing water penetration.
- Duration of protection: Check the manufacturer’s claims regarding the duration of protection provided by the coating. Be wary of exaggerated or unsubstantiated claims.
- Compatibility with materials: Ensure that the coating is compatible with your camera gear and other sensitive equipment.
Sealed Zippers and Stress Points
A sealed zipper is a critical component in any water-resistant bag. Look for bags with double-stitched zippers, reinforced stress points, and anti-slip coatings to prevent zipping issues.
Additionally, consider the type of closure system used. Some bags may use magnetic closures or snap closures, which can be more secure than traditional zippers.
